Output 594d29383a2a028abc812416c3d6effa09ea0bd1143fd1d8699387152694621a:1

value
1453785
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 da84fec68235ebea1dc8745a1406c5f998e66c7ff58f6b37ffcdee8e2f7f98e5
address
bc1pm2z0a35zxh4758wgw3dpgpk9lxvwvmrl7k8kkdllehhgutmlnrjsdhkecq
transaction
594d29383a2a028abc812416c3d6effa09ea0bd1143fd1d8699387152694621a
spent
true